Jatropha Biodiesel-FT Blends Reduce Most Criteria Pollutants Compared to Neat FT; Higher NOx

Green Car Congress

The authors tested JBD blended with FT fuel in volumetric ratios of 0:100, 25:75, 50:50, 75:25, and 100:0 (B0, B25, B50, B75, and B100). However, NO x emissions were higher, and the engine thermal efficiency was slightly lower with higher JBD blends. Compared to FT fuel, higher JBD blends showed higher BSFC and lower thermal efficiency.
